**Q: Who maintains the Larchpress markdown pipeline?**

The Larchpress rendering pipeline is owned by the Documentation Platform team. Before reporting an issue, please check the known-limitations page, as several edge cases in table rendering are already tracked. For anything not covered there, reach the maintainers directly at the address below.

billing contact of yawip-yadup = druath.casdor@nelvrolabs.internal

Present: finance team plus Mira and Josten from partnerships.

Quick rundown on the Lumawell reseller programme: sign-ups are ahead of plan, but discount stacking is eating into margin more than expected. Finance to model a cap on combined discounts before next quarter. Invoicing for tier-two partners moves to monthly cycles starting soon — watch the cash flow impact. Josten flagged two partners requesting extended terms; decision deferred. The thinking behind where we take this next is noted below.

confidential, kagep-kahof: Druokax Systems plans to lower the Ulaath list price by 53 percent in March.

# Approvals — CastCheck Validator

All changes to the podcast feed validator require one approval before merge. Schema changes (RSS extensions, enclosure rules) require two. Hotfixes to the parser may ship with retroactive review within 24 hours, but must be flagged in the release channel. Do not approve your own changes, even trivial ones. Validation rule additions need a fixture demonstrating both pass and fail cases. Approval authority rotates quarterly; check this page after each rotation. Current approver of record:

named custodian: Brivan Eliath Quenox Frador